### Account Recovery — AddrSnap Widget Console

When an operator is locked out of the AddrSnap autocomplete admin console, verify their identity against the Delvane staff roster, then initiate the break-glass flow from a trusted workstation. The flow regenerates session keys and invalidates prior tokens. Completing the final step requires the recovery passphrase noted below.

recovery phrase for bawef-haduf: wenax-druox-julmir

## Escalation: Catalog Cache Invalidation

If stale prices show up in Shelfwright's product catalog after a publish, don't panic — it's almost always the invalidation fanout lagging behind the Burrowdale write path. First, check the purge queue depth; anything over 10k means the sweeper is wedged. Restart the sweeper pod once, wait five minutes, and re-check. If items are still stale after two restarts, stop poking it and escalate to the Catalog Platform crew. You can reach the on-duty escalation owner here.

alerts address for kajog-tadup: druox@plorvanet.internal

## Flume-MQ 4.2 — compaction defaults changed

Log compaction now runs eagerly instead of on the hourly timer. Segments compact once dirty ratio exceeds the threshold, cutting disk growth on busy topics but adding steady background I/O. Old behavior is gone; the timer knob is ignored and logged as deprecated. Operators who tuned for the hourly cycle should re-check disk and CPU headroom before upgrading brokers. New defaults applied on upgrade are listed below.

service settings:
[pelox]
team = gilael
access_code = ac_792427
host = pelox.qirvandata.example
port = 11211
owner = fenok.novwyn
peer = novmir.norvastack.corp

Subject: Velmora term sheet — summary

Executive team,

For the incoming director's awareness: Velmora Systems has returned a revised term sheet for the co-development of the Ashgrove platform. Key points: 60/40 cost split in our favour, shared IP on integrations, and a two-year exclusivity window in the Norvale region. Outstanding issues are the termination fee and audit rights. We meet their negotiators next Thursday. Our confidential position going into that meeting is noted below.

internal memo for kawip-hadug: Headcount on the Wenwyn team goes from 7 to 140 by the end of January. Gross margin on Wenwyn came in at 20 percent against a plan of 15 percent.